A CAN'S DIAMETER IS 3 INCHES, AND IT HEIGHT IS 8 INCHES. WHAT IS THE VOLUME OF THE CAN.

To find the volume of a can, we need to use the formula for the volume of a cylinder. The formula is:

Volume = π * (radius^2) * height

Given that the diameter of the can is 3 inches, we can find the radius by dividing the diameter by 2:

Radius = diameter / 2 = 3 / 2 = 1.5 inches

Now, we can substitute the values into the formula:

Volume = π * (1.5^2) * 8

To calculate the volume, we need to know the value of π. π (pi) is a mathematical constant that represents the ratio of a circle's circumference to its diameter. The approximate value of π is 3.14159.

Now, let's calculate the volume:

Volume ≈ 3.14159 * (1.5^2) * 8

Volume ≈ 3.14159 * 2.25 * 8

Volume ≈ 56.548667 in³ (rounded to six decimal places)

Therefore, the volume of the can is approximately 56.548667 cubic inches.
